The Faculty of Forestry, Universitas Sumatera Utara (USU), held a meeting to discuss progress and strategies for ASIIN International Accreditation as part of efforts to strengthen academic quality and global competitiveness.

HUMAS FAHUTAN – The Faculty of Forestry, Universitas Sumatera Utara (USU), held a Progress Meeting on ASIIN International Accreditation on Thursday, 8 January 2026, at the Meeting Room of the Faculty of Forestry, USU. This meeting was part of the faculty’s ongoing efforts to ensure the readiness of all documents and supporting aspects toward achieving international accreditation.

 

The meeting was attended by faculty leaders, including the Vice Dean I, Dr. Ir. Alfan Gunawan Ahmad, S.Hut., M.Si., the Head of the Undergraduate Forestry Study Program, Dr. Ir. Tito Sucipto, S.Hut., M.Si., IPU., ASEAN Eng., the Secretary of the Undergraduate Forestry Study Program, Dr. Evalina Herawati, S.Hut., M.Si., the Secretary of the Master’s Forestry Study Program, Dr. Nurdin Sulistiyono, S.Hut., M.Si., expert staff, the Head of Administrative Affairs, subdivision heads, as well as educational support staff.

 

During the meeting, participants comprehensively discussed the progress of ASIIN accreditation that has been achieved, while also identifying various challenges still faced in meeting international standards.

In addition to evaluating achievements, the meeting focused on strategic discussions regarding acceleration measures and solutions to existing constraints, covering academic aspects, curriculum, governance, and administrative support. Each unit was given the opportunity to provide input to further strengthen the readiness of the Faculty of Forestry, USU, for the next stages of the accreditation process.

 

Through this meeting, the Faculty of Forestry, USU reaffirmed its commitment to continuously improving the quality of education and academic governance, while strengthening the faculty’s position at both national and international levels in line with Universitas Sumatera Utara’s vision toward global recognition.
